Comprehending the Mechanics of Door Mortise Hinges
Door mortise joints are designed to fit into a mortise or recess cut into the edge of the door and the door frame. This type of hinge is widely appreciated for its clean, flush appearance as soon as mounted, as it permits the joint to be almost undetectable when the door is closed. Mortising the door and framework offers a snug suitable for the joint, improving the door's stability and strength.
Advantages of Door Mortise Hinges:
Appearances: Mortise pivots offer a sleek and tidy look, as they are embedded right into the door and framework, making them virtually unseen when the door is shut.
Sturdiness: The snug match the door and framework provides a secure and resilient link, minimizing the possibility of sagging with time.
Safety: Mortise joints are challenging to damage due to their recessed setup, offering an added layer of safety and security to your home.
Discovering Non-Mortise Door Hinges
Non-mortise door hinges, on the other hand, are developed for simplicity of installment without the demand for cutting a mortise into the door or framework. These joints are placed on the surface, making them an optimal option for DIY tasks or applications where a fast installment is preferred.
While non-mortise door hinges offer simplicity and benefit in setup, it's important to consider these advantages versus the details demands and problems of your job. Unlike their mortise equivalents, non-mortise hinges do not require the door or frame to be removed, that makes them especially appropriate for jobs where preserving the integrity of the door and frame is extremely important. In addition, the adaptability of non-mortise door hinges makes them an appealing choice for lightweight doors or indoor applications where the aesthetic appeal of a flush coating is not a key issue. However, for larger doors or locations that require boosted safety, the robust nature of mortise joints may be preferable, regardless of the additional job involved in their installment.
Advantages of Non-Mortise Door Hinges:
Easy Installation: With no requirement for mortising, non-mortise joints can be set up quickly and quickly, conserving time and effort.
Adaptability: Non-mortise hinges are flexible and can be made use of on a range of door kinds, consisting of interior doors, cupboard doors, and shutters.
Cost-Effective: Typically, non-mortise hinges are extra cost effective than mortise hinges, making them a affordable choice for several homeowners.
Selecting the Right Hinge for Your Doors
When deciding between door mortise hinges and non-mortise door hinges, think about the following aspects:
Application: Determine where and just how the joint will certainly be made use of. Mortise joints are suitable for hefty doors calling for a safe and secure and durable joint, while non-mortise joints appropriate for lighter doors and easier setups.
Aesthetic appeals: If the appearance of the hinge is a top priority, mortise joints use a more seamless appearance. Nonetheless, non-mortise hinges are available in various coatings to match your design.
Installation: Consider your ability degree and the tools readily available. Non-mortise hinges are more DIY-friendly, whereas mortise joints may call for more advanced devices and methods for installment.
